Transaction 3888ce649b4967336c0951bb5282e9604ee3a6acec27581f45d290c8b17ed129
2 Input
2 Outputs
- 3888ce649b4967336c0951bb5282e9604ee3a6acec27581f45d290c8b17ed129:0
- 3888ce649b4967336c0951bb5282e9604ee3a6acec27581f45d290c8b17ed129:1
value 17145115
address 1KJVMj97iKoxJf1uSNakGbYJ3TTyCrwLUg
value 224310290
address 3GRmWZihwNPZaxSMikHrTagH6ncnwD45Pg